Common uses & context

Decimal 149 (0x95) falls in the C1 control range (128–159). In the Latin-1 (ISO-8859-1) encoding these code points are unassigned control positions with no visible glyph, and in Windows-1252 many of them were repurposed for typographic characters like curly quotes and the em dash. That mismatch is a classic cause of mojibake: a byte stored as Windows-1252 but decoded as Latin-1 (or UTF-8) shows the wrong character or a replacement box.

In modern Unicode, U+0095 is a C1 control code. Its UTF-8 encoding is the two-byte sequence 0xC2 0x95, which is why a raw high byte 0x95 from a legacy Latin-1 file becomes garbled when a program assumes UTF-8.

Unicode & UTF-8 note

In Unicode this is U+0095. In UTF-8 it encodes to the byte sequence 0xC2 0x95. In legacy Latin-1 (ISO-8859-1) it is a single byte 0x95, which is why Latin-1 files often appear as mojibake when interpreted as UTF-8.
